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Blue Valley). They took their matchup on Tuesday with ease, bagging a 78-16 victory over the Wakefield Bombers. That result was just more of the same for these two, as the Rams also won the last time the pair played back in December of 2023.
Despite the loss, Wakefield still got an impressive performance from Kingsley Smith, who almost dropped a double-double on 11 points and nine boards. Smith is on a roll when it comes to rebounds, as he's now pulled down nine or more in the last six games he's played.
Blue Valley's win was their fifth stra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 6-4-1. Those victories came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 62.0 points per game. As for Wakefield,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 1-11.
Blue Valley has already played their next game (against Doniphan West),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. Wakefield w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next contest, a 68-47 loss against Canton-Galva on the 1st.
